Reporting Date: 22.10.2011
Cheetah like other big cats, kill their prey by strangulation. They hunt mainly medium-size antelops particularly Thompsons gazelles and Impala. Cheetahs hunt mostly during the first few morning hours and the last few evening hours.
This morning the two cheetahs nickname artur brothers were seen by Alex and his four guest hunting and killing a young steenbok in the Maasai Mara. After subduing the steenbok they guickly started feeding to avoid interferance from lions and hyena.
